1 csrc = $(wildcard src/*.c)
2 ssrc = $(wildcard src/*.asm)
3 obj = $(csrc:.c=.o) $(ssrc:.asm=.o)
15 CFLAGS = -march=i8088 -mtune=i8088 -MMD
18 dd if=/dev/zero of=$@ bs=512 count=$(disk_numsec)
19 dd if=$< of=$@ bs=512 conv=notrunc
22 $(LD) -T kern.ld -Map kern.map -o $@ $(obj)
40 qemu-system-i386 -fda $(img) -serial file:serial.log
44 qemu-system-i386 -fda $(img) -serial file:serial.log -s -S
48 ndisasm -o 0x7c00 $< >dis1
49 ndisasm -o 0x98000 -e 512 $< >dis2